## Notice

This Prior Information Notice ("PIN") has been issued by Offshore Renewable Energy ("ORE") Catapult, in relation to the requirement to build a Robotics and Autonomous Systems Test & Validation Centre ("R&AS") Command and Control Centre. The building is expected to be over two floors, approximately 360m2 in floorspace and include office space, engineering workshops, welfare facilities. Full occupancy is expected by Q1 2022, with build costs estimated in the region of PS1m. This PIN is for market research purposes only and will only be used to engage with the market and not used to reduce the timescales of the procurement activity. Due to the complexity of the facility, it is anticipated that the procurement exercise will follow the "Competitive with negotiation" process, with one main contractor being appointed to deliver. Background: The accelerated testing, demonstration and validation in simulated testing facilities will reduce both the time and high cost associated in actual field testing, allowing faster adoption of cutting-edge subsea robotics technology, saving the offshore renewable energy sector costs in operation and maintenance performance and provide new market opportunities for businesses and innovators. In the UK (and internationally) there is a lack of facilities able to test and validate R&AS for offshore renewable energy applications. ORE Catapult already has the world's largest collection of offshore renewables test assets, these proposed enhancements in R&AS infrastructure will generate a world class capability in the North East of England.
